2022-07-23 06:12:35 Una frase más para la colección: “no me importa seis peniques”.

Tell Mary that I make over Mr. Heartley and all his estate to her for her sole use and benefit in future, and not only him, but all my other admirers into the bargain wherever she can find them, even the kiss which C. Powlett wanted to give me, as I mean to confine myself in future to Mr. Tom Lefroy, for whom I don't care sixpence.
Carta de Jane Austen a Cassandra Austen, 1796

I don’t care sixpence for any of the opinions you mention, on such a subject…
Walter Scott

"Ekaterina Schulmann, one of the 2022 judges, said: “In one of the darkest years in post-WWII world history, I think it is particularly honourable of Pushkin House to keep rewarding painstaking scholarship and dedicated studies of Russian history, societal development and culture that are both fundamental and approachable. These books reflect the varieties and revel in the richness of human experience and endeavour that are so easy to lose sight of but should be preserved as an integral part of our shared humanity. The Pushkin House Book Prize is faithful to its mission of fostering and encouraging deeper understanding of the immense complexities of cultures within and beyond Russia.”

The 2022 shortlisted titles are:
On the Edge: Life along the Russia-China Border by Frank Billie and Caroline Humphrey
Navalny: Putin’s Nemesis, Russia’s Future? by Jan Matti Dollbaum, Morvan Lallouet and Ben Noble
Weak Strongman: The limits of power in Putin’s Russia by Timothy Frye
Klimat: Russian in the Age of Climate Change by Thane Gustafson
Not One Inch: America, Russia, and the Making of Post-Cold War Stalemate by Mary Sarotte
In Memory of Memory by Maria Stepanova
Stalin’s Architect: Power and Survival in Moscow by Deyan Sudjic
The Empress and the English Doctor: How Catherine the Great defied a deadly virus by Lucy Ward
Playing with Fire: The Story of Maria Yudina, Pianist in Stalin’s Russia by Elizabeth Wilson
Collapse: The Fall of the Soviet Union by Vladislav Zubok".
